Asia is the most points-favorable hotel region in the world. Park Hyatt at 25,000-30,000 points/night produces 2.5-3.5¢/point on aspirational properties. Combined with cheap business class redemptions on JAL via Alaska Mileage Plan (50,000-70,000 miles off-peak Asia 1) or ANA via Virgin Atlantic (55,000-60,000 miles each way), Asian trips on points produce dramatic cents-per-point value. Here are the 10 strongest 2026 Asian cities.

The 2026 Asian city ranking

RankCityWhy it wins
1TokyoPark Hyatt Tokyo Cat 7 30k Hyatt = 3¢/point. ANA via Virgin Atlantic 55-60k each way.
2BangkokPark Hyatt Bangkok Cat 5 20k Hyatt = 2.5¢/point. Lufthansa to BKK via LifeMiles 95k.
3SingaporeSingapore Suites via KrisFlyer 155k post-Nov 2025. Andaz Singapore 25k Hyatt.
4KyotoPark Hyatt Kyoto Cat 7 30k Hyatt. Connection from Tokyo or Osaka.
5Hong KongCathay First Class via Alaska 70k + $30. Hyatt Centric Causeway Bay 15k Hyatt.
6SeoulKorean Air via SkyTeam (Flying Blue Promo). Hyatt Regency Seoul 15-20k.
7BaliSingapore Airlines via SIN. Conrad Bali 50-70k Hilton + 5th-night-free.
8SaigonPark Hyatt Saigon Cat 6 25k Hyatt = 1.6¢/point. Vietnam Airlines + AAdvantage path.
9MumbaiAir India direct via LifeMiles 78k + $25. Qatar QSuite via DOH path.
10PhuketHyatt Regency Phuket Cat 4 15k Hyatt. Bangkok connection on LifeMiles.

The Park Hyatt Tokyo flagship

Park Hyatt Tokyo at Cat 7 = 30,000 World of Hyatt points/night is the most-iconic Asian luxury hotel-points redemption. The property occupies the upper floors of the Shinjuku skyscraper (made famous by Lost in Translation). At ~$900-$1,200/night cash equivalent, that's 3.0-4.0¢/point in cents-per-point value.

The ANA THE Room sweet spot

ANA THE Room business class on the 777-300ER (US-Tokyo routes) is one of the strongest premium-cabin products globally. Virgin Atlantic Flying Club at 55,000-60,000 miles + ~$200 each way is the cheapest published rate to Tokyo on any partner program. Combined with Tokyo's Park Hyatt or Andaz aspirational hotels, this is a strong combined trip.

The Singapore Suites flagship

Singapore Suites on the A380 is the most-aspirational First Class redemption in points travel. Post-November 2025 devaluation: ~155,000 KrisFlyer miles each way US-Singapore. Combined with Andaz Singapore at 25k Hyatt for the post-flight stay, the trip produces $20,000+ in cents-per-point value.

The Bangkok value

Bangkok is the cheapest aspirational Park Hyatt redemption in points travel — Park Hyatt Bangkok at Cat 5 = 20,000 Hyatt points/night. Combined with the iconic Penthouse Bar location and ~$500-$700/night cash equivalents, this produces 2.5-3.5¢/point.

The Hong Kong + Cathay combination

Hong Kong via Alaska Mileage Plan at 70,000 miles for Cathay First Class (the cheapest published Cathay First on any program) + Hyatt Centric Causeway Bay at Cat 4 = 15,000 Hyatt points/night produces:

  • Round-trip Cathay First: 140,000 Alaska miles + ~$60 cash (cents-per-point ~21¢ on the flight)
  • 5 nights Hyatt Centric Causeway Bay: 75,000 Hyatt points + ~$0 cash
  • Total: 140,000 Alaska + 75,000 Hyatt + ~$100 cash
  • Cash retail equivalent: ~$30,000+ in flight + hotel

The Bali and Phuket sweet spots

Indonesian and Thai island destinations produce strong hotel-points value:

  • Conrad Bali: 50-70k Hilton points/night + 5th-night-free benefit
  • Hyatt Regency Phuket: Cat 4 = 15k Hyatt points/night
  • Andaz Bali: Cat 5-6 = 20-25k Hyatt points/night

The Mumbai + Qatar QSuite combination

For travelers wanting QSuite-level premium-cabin to Asia:

  • JFK-DOH on Qatar QSuite via AAdvantage: 70,000 + ~$200 each way
  • DOH-BOM on Qatar via AAdvantage: ~50,000 + ~$80 each way (intra-Asia)
  • Total round-trip: ~240,000 AA miles + ~$560 cash

The peak season considerations

  • Tokyo: Avoid cherry blossom (late March-April) and Golden Week (late April-early May)
  • Bangkok / Phuket: Avoid October-March is high season; book early
  • Singapore: Weather is consistent year-round; avoid Chinese New Year for crowds
  • Bali: Avoid July-August + December-January for crowds

Bottom line

The strongest Asian cities for points travel in 2026 are Tokyo (Park Hyatt 30k Hyatt + ANA THE Room 55-60k Virgin Atlantic), Bangkok (Park Hyatt 20k Hyatt at the cheapest), and Hong Kong (Cathay First 70k Alaska + Hyatt Centric 15k Hyatt). For Chase-anchored stacks (Hyatt access), Tokyo and Bangkok are the top picks. For Citi-anchored stacks (AAdvantage access), Hong Kong via Cathay and Mumbai via Qatar are the strongest paths.

How does Citi ThankYou Points transfer to partners?

Citi ThankYou Points transfers 1:1 to 15+ partners including American AAdvantage (uniquely Citi among major flexible-points), JetBlue TrueBlue, Avianca LifeMiles, Singapore KrisFlyer, Virgin Atlantic, Cathay Asia Miles, Turkish Miles & Smiles, Aeroplan, Qatar Privilege Club, Aeromexico. JAL Mileage Bank transfers at 3:1 (unfavorable but unique direct path). Transfer bonuses run 1-2 active per month, often favoring Turkish, LifeMiles, and Singapore KrisFlyer.

How do off-peak award rates work for European travel?

Most fixed-chart airline programs publish off-peak / standard / peak windows with 12,500-22,500 mile differential per direction. AAdvantage US-Europe business class: 57,500 off-peak / 70,000 standard each way (off-peak typically January 10-March 14 + November 1-December 14). Aeroplan publishes a fixed partner award chart at 70,000 each way US-Europe regardless of season. Avianca LifeMiles charges 63,000 fixed each way. Most dynamic programs (Delta, United, peak-period programs) charge 100-200% more during peak holiday windows. Plan trips for off-peak windows for meaningful savings.
